The economic problems of recent years may soon appear.

Russians florets. According to analysts, the country faces a sharp acceleration.

inflation, rising prices and other troubles that had already been dealt with in 2008. At least an associate professor of the Department of Financial Markets.

and financial engineering RASHiGS Sergey Hestanov believes that the current record fall in the indices.

Nikkei and Dow Jones predicts a dark future for Russia too. "The danger is that such a sharp fall.

may not be a correction, but the beginning of a full-scale crisis, as.

in 2008, "- he said in an interview with" URA. RU ". Russia is this, in his.

opinion, threatens to sell off in the stock market, therefore, the fall.

ruble and the stock market, rising inflation and unemployment. However, not everyone shares such a gloomy outlook. Analyst.

of the company "Discovery Broker" Timur.

Nigmatullin is convinced that in the world markets there is now a slight panic caused by.

the situation in the USA. But it will not spread far: "It is necessary to pay attention to the heavily overheated.

US stock market. Acceleration of GDP growth rates and tax reform.

led to the fact that the price of shares was severely torn off.

from their intrinsic value ", - the expert lists negative.

factors. The stock indices, in his opinion, are also influenced by the shift.

head of the Federal Reserve and new parameters of stress tests for American banks. Does not improve.

situation and tough views of US President Donald Trump on the development of foreign trade.

relations with the People's Republic of China and the European Union. The record fall of the Japanese index Nikkei 225 was.

it is fixed on Tuesday, February 6. In the bidding process, it fell by 6% and.

closed as a result in the minus 4.73%. Other world exchanges also seriously lost:.

Hong Kong's Hang Seng sank 5.

1%, the American Dow Jones collapsed below the level.

in 25 thousand items. The impact was also affected in Europe: British and German.

indexes were down 3% - earlier this was only when.

the supporters of Brexit won the referendum in Great Britain. Note that on Wednesday, the Japanese Nikkei was able to play a small.

part of its losses, but Hang Seng continued to fall. The world market does not have.

cause for optimism.
